10. The volume of Cube A is 125 cubic inches. The face of Cube B has an area of 36 square inches.
Which cube has a greater side length?

We have,
To compare the side lengths of Cube A and Cube B, we need to find the side length of each cube.
For Cube A:
The volume of Cube A = side length³
125 = side length³
To find the side length of Cube A, we take the cube root of 125:
side length of Cube A = ∛125 ≈ 5 inches
For Cube B:
The area of one face of Cube B = side length²
36 = side length²
To find the side length of Cube B, we take the square root of 36:
side length of Cube B = √36 = 6 inches
Now, we can compare the side lengths of both cubes:
The side length of Cube A ≈ 5 inches
The side length of Cube B = 6 inches
Since 6 inches is greater than 5 inches, Cube B has a greater side length than Cube A.
Thus,
Cube B has a greater side length than Cube A.

Two boats leave the same marina. One heads north, and the other heads
east. After some time, the northbound boat has traveled 39 kilometers, and
the eastbound boat has traveled 52 kilometers. How far apart are the two
boats
The distance travelled by the two boats forms a right triangle. Thus, applying the Pythagorean Theorem we find out that the two boats are 65 kilometers apart from each other after travelling 39 kilometers north and 52 kilometers east. Thus, 1st option is correct.
It is given to us that -
There are two boats
One boat heads north while the other heads east
The boat travelling north has traveled 39 kilometers
The boat travelling south has traveled 52 kilometers
We have to find out the distance between the two boats after they have travelled the respective distances.
It is known to us that one boat heads north while the other heads east. We can see that the trajectory formed between the two boats resembles a right triangle as they start from the same point.
One leg of the right triangle formed equals to the distance travelled by the boat travelling north.
Let us say the distance travelled by the boat travelling north be "a".
=> a = 39 kilometers ----- (1)
Other leg of the right triangle formed equals to the distance travelled by the boat travelling east.
Let us say the distance travelled by the boat travelling east be "b".
=> b = 52 kilometers ------ (2)
Now, the distance between the two boats after they have travelled the respective distances is equal to the value of the hypotenuse of the right triangle formed.
Let us say the hypotenuse of the right triangle formed be "h".
According to the Pythagorean Theorem for a right triangle,
\(a^{2} +b^{2} =h^{2}\) ---- (3)
where, a, b = legs of the right triangle
and, h = hypotenuse of the right triangle
Substituting the values of a and b from equations (1) and (2) respectively in equation (3), we have
\(a^{2} +b^{2} =h^{2}\\= > 39^{2} +52^{2} =h^{2}\\= > h^{2}=1521+2704\\= > h^{2}=4225\\= > h=65\)
So, the value of the hypotenuse of the right triangle formed is 65 kilometers.
Thus, applying the Pythagorean Theorem we find out that the two boats are 65 kilometers apart from each other after travelling 39 kilometers north and 52 kilometers east. Thus, 1st option is correct.

22. Tad and Timothy went to the paint store together. Tad bought 6 cans of paint
and 1 paint brush for $67. Timothy bought 4 cans of the same paint and 3 of
the same type of paint brushes. Timothy’s total cost was $54.
(Let x represent the cost of a can of paint and y represent the cost of a paint brush.)
a. Solve the system of linear equations using the substitution method.
b. What was the cost for a can of paint?
c. The cost of a paint brush?
Answer:
Can of Paint = $10.50
Paint Brush = $4
Step-by-step explanation:
P and B are paintbrushes and brushes. x and y are the numbers of P and B, respectively.
x y
P B $
Tad 6 1 67
Tim 4 3 54
We can form two equations from the above table:
For Tad: 6x + 1y = 67 [the numbers of paint and brushes times their costs, x and y, is the total Tad paid, $67]
For Tim: 4x + 3y = 54 {Same approach]
We have two equations and two unknowns, so let's rearrange on one of the equations to isolate one of the two variables, and then use that in the other equation. I'll pick the first and rearrange it for y:
6x + 1y = 67
y = 67-6x
Now use this value of y in the second equation:
4x + 3y = 54
4x + 3(67-6x) = 54
4x + 201 -18x = 54
-14x = - 147
x = $10.5 The price of a can of paint is $10.50
Now use this value of x in either equation and solve for y:
6x + 1y = 67
y = 67-6*(10.5)
y = 67-63
y = $4 The price for a brush is $4
===================
See if these values work:
Did Tad pay the correct amount?:
6x + 1y = 67
6($10.5) + 1($4) = $67 ??
$63 + $4 = $67 YES
How about for Timothy?
4x + 3y = 54
4($10.5) + 3($4) = 54?
$42 + $12 = $54
The values are correct.

15. The length of a rectangle is four times its width. If its width is x^5 units, what is the area of the rectangle?
16. The width of a rectangular prism is six times its length. The height is five times its length. If its length is m units, what is the volume of the prism?
Answer:
15. 4x¹⁰
16. 30m³
Step-by-step explanation:
15. Area of Rectangle is given by A=LW
since W=x⁵ and L is 4 times W, L=4x⁵
therefore, A = x⁵(4x⁵) = 4x¹⁰
16. Volume of Rectangular Prism is V=LWH
W=6L=6m and H=5L=5m and L=m
so V = m(6m)(5m) = 30m³
